⚠️ Scaling for Other Material Thicknesses
If your material thickness is not included, you can scale the file carefully.
- Import a file version made for material thicker than your actual material.
- Multiply the width and height of the imported file by your actual material thickness.
- Divide the result by the material thickness of the imported file.
Example: If your material is 4.5 mm thick, import the 5 mm file. Then multiply the width and height by 4.5 and divide by 5. This will give you a file scaled for 4.5 mm material.
